In a piece for Life Hacker, Angus Kidman said existing without an
Aussie credit card is not impossible, although having one can make it simpler to do certain things such as amassing frequent flyer and bonus points in various establishments.
But he warned that even individuals who are careful and pay off their debt on a regular basis are likely to end up forking out for an annual fee on their credit card.
Mr Kidman added: "There are no-fee cards on the market, but those often have some other form of trade-off."
And there should also be other factors to weigh up, including
interest-free periods, reward schemes and extra benefits.
In addition, CommSec chief economist Craig James noted earlier this month that credit card debt is being accumulated at its slowest rate for 16 years, the Courier Mail reported.
